Let's begin by discussing the roles and their respective job market trends: 1. **Hydrologist**: Hydrologists study the distribution, circulation, and physical properties of water within the Earth's systems. With a growing demand for professionals who can manage and protect water resources, the job market trend for hydrologists is on the rise. 2. **Water Resources Engineer**: Water Resources Engineers are responsible for designing and implementing systems that efficiently manage water resources. As the UK faces increasing challenges related to water scarcity and quality, the demand for skilled Water Resources Engineers continues to grow. 3. **Water Quality Scientist**: Water Quality Scientists focus on monitoring, analyzing, and maintaining the quality of water in various environments. With heightened public awareness of water quality and stricter regulations, the job market for Water Quality Scientists is seeing a steady increase. 4. **Water Rights Specialist**: Water Rights Specialists manage the legal aspects of water resource allocation and use. As water rights continue to be a contentious issue in the UK, the demand for professionals with expertise in this area is on the rise.
